lighthouse2The Kilauea Lighthouse began lighting the way for mariners in 1913. It served as a pivotal navigation aid for ships sailing on the Orient run.  The historic light station consists of a concrete lighthouse, three field stone keepers’ quarters, a fuel oil shed, cisterns, and a supply landing platform. It is one of the nations most intact historic light stations.

Even in the early years, travelers came to enjoy the area’s scenic beauty and to explore the magnificent light. Today Kilauea Point is one of Kauai’s most visited sites with more than 500,00 visitors a year.  The landmark played a prominent role in the life of the nearby sugar plantation town of Kilauea. The lighthouse is a symbol of the town; and the Point is one the island’s best loved places.

Kilauea Point is listed on the State and National Registers of Historic Places. After the light was decommissioned in 1976, the US Fish and Wildlife acquired it in 1985 and currently manages the 31-acre site as part of a 203-acre wildlife refuge.  Dedicated in 1913 the Kilauea Lighthouse served as a pivotal navigation aid for ships on the Orient run.

Help us restore this precious gem by purchasing a personalized brick.  Time and the harsh tropic marine environment have taken their toll on the historic buildings. The result is a site now in critical condition.

Recognizing the local and national value of the light station, the current USFWS administration sought advice from the community on ways to restore and care for the Point’s historic resources.The not-for-profit organization association with the refuge, the Kilauea Point Natural History Association, expanded it’s mission to include historic preservation and established a dedicated Kilauea Point Historic Preservation Fund.

A community-based historic preservation committee was established to undertake the planning, fund-raising, restoration, maintenance, and interpretation of the site (and more volunteers are needed!)  Preservation professionals assessed the condition of the resources and prepared a preservation and maintenance plan for the light station. In it, the national experts detail the considerable damage and deterioration and lay out a straight forward approach for preservation and continuing maintenance.
